General Information about #2C2238

#2C2238, also known as Bleached Cedar, is a dark, muted shade of purple-brown. It exhibits a subtle elegance and sophistication due to its understated nature. In the RGB color model, it is composed of 17.25% red, 13.33% green, and 21.96% blue. This color is often associated with feelings of calmness, stability, and introspection. Its hexadecimal representation is frequently used in web design, graphic arts, and other creative fields. Bleached Cedar can be effectively employed to create backgrounds, text elements, or accent colors, providing a refined and subtle aesthetic. It's versatile enough to be paired with a variety of other colors, ranging from neutrals to brighter shades, depending on the desired effect.
